This app costs $10 and is almost every penny! In this app, you write articles for all the top blogging sites like, WordPress, Blogger, and more!

ALL WORDPRESS ONLY USERS: The offical WordPress app (Which is free) is much better for just WordPress blogs, I like this app because I have a Blogger and WordPress blog.


Cons-

  • It looks really plain
  • You cannot post pictures to blogger (this feature is coming in iBlogger 2)
  • You can only add one picture to a post
  • You cannot add video or html to a post
  • When adding a picture, it auto crops to a square

Pros-

  • The ability to post to blogger (I could not find any other app that let me do that)
  • Being able to manage mutiple blogs hosted by different sites
  • Ability to edit old posts and erase old posts
  • Ability to add links
